21.6.2010 HYÖTY SENSORIVERKOISTA Hotelli Pasila, Helsinki Wirepas-projektin tulokset ja WSN openapi -rajapintakehitys Marko Hännikäinen, Professori, TTY 1
Sisältö Wirepas projekti TUTWSN teknologia Piloteista WSN openapi Toimintamalli Johtopäätökset 2
DACI Research Group 1997-2010 Department on Computer Systems Prof. Marko Hännikäinen, Prof. Timo D. Hämäläinen 12 years experience on WLAN and WSN research 18 research projects with 200+ person years About 30 employed researchers annually on average Outcome 1997-2010 250+ publications, 12 PhD theses, 60+ MSc theses 10+ patents and patent applications 2 spin-off companies 3
Wirepas-projekti 2008-2010 Teknologian soveltuvuutta ja hyödynnettävyyttä osana nykyisiä ja uusia tuotealueita ja prosesseja Teknisiä rajapintoja ja menetelmiä joilla WSN liitetään ja integroidaan sujuvasti ja taloudellisesti osaksi muita järjestelmiä Arvoverkostoja ja liiketoimintamahdollisuuksia WSN-verkkojen hyödyntämiseksi 4
TUTWSN-teknologia 5
TUTWSN-verkko TTY:n TUTWSN-mittausverkko Dynaaminen mesh-verkko automaattinen toiminta Pieni energiankulutus Luotettavuus erilaisissa ympäristöissä Päästä päähän toteutus 2,4 GHz ja 433 MHz taajuusalueet Lämpötila, ilmankosteus, valoisuus, CO2, liiketunnistus, kosketus, kiintyvyys, ovikytkin, melu/äänenpaine, maakosteus, sähkönkulutus, paikannus, ilmamäärä, hälytyspainike, mahdollisuus ohjaukselle Node Node Node Node Node Node Gate way 6
TUTWSN (2.4 GHz), wireless sensor/router node and gateway node Auxliary sensors 7 Battery powered Ethernet DC power Memory card (microsd)
Online java + web + sms applications 8
Piloteista 9
TUTWSN-sovellusarkkitehtuuri TUTWSN: mittaus, ohjaus paikannus Ympäristömittaukset Henkilöpaikannus TUTWSN sovellukset Palveluntarjoajat Loppukäyttäjät Integraattorit Asiakkaan taustajärjestelmät Palveluintegrointi (esim. Google) Kotiverkko INTERNET (intranet, mobiili) SQL/ DB DB Java Messaging Service JMS XML TCP XML (SOAP, SIP) OPC RMI SIP TCP/IP sockets 10 Gateway Tehdasmittaukset Kiinteistömittaukset Kuljetusten monitorointi, logistiikka Hallinta- ja mitoitustyökalut TUTWSN Gateway Software Rajapintastandardit sovelluksille ja taustajärjestelmiin
11 Pilotti Pilotin aihe Alkoi Nodeja (n.) Elisa, FutureLabs Kiinteistömittaukset 2007 45 Metso, Voikkaa Solvay Tehdasalueen mittaukset ja 03/2009 100 Chemicals jätevesilinjan valvonta Avack, Kainuun keskussairaala Sairaalan henkilöturvajärjestelmä ja 2008 110 henkilöpaikannus Kemi-Tornion Kiinteistömittaukset ja tilojen 2009 116 ammattikorkeakoulu käyttöaste TTY/Kotiverkko Asuinkiinteistön mittaus- ja 2007 30 valvontaverkko TTY/Ympäristömittaukset Maatalous- ja ympäristömittaukset 2005 40 ulkona TTY/Opetusverkko Opetuskäyttö, kiinteistömittaukset 2008 350 Kainuun maakunta Työolosuhdemittaukset 2008 30 kuntayhtymä Lepolan Puutarha Oy Kasvihuoneen ilmaston mittaukset 2009 30 KPO/Ebsolut Kuljetusten valvonta 2009 40 Poliisiammatti-korkeakoulu Henkilöpaikannus harjoitustilanteessa 2007 100 Fatman Oy Tilapäiset kiinteistömittaukset 2009 20 TTY/Maatalous Mittausverkon pilotointi karjatilalla 2009 30
12
13
14
15
16
17
18
19
20
21
22
23
Elisa Teknologiapäällikkö Jari Peuralahti Frends Tohtori Juha Nurmilaakso Futurice Olli Mahlamäki Tampereen Teknillinen Yliopisto Mika Vuori Olli Kivelä Markus Rentto Prof. Marko Hännikäinen wsn openapi http://openapi.elisalabs.fi 24
openapi Yhteinäistetään WSNrajapintoja sekä hallintaa WSN käyttöönotto, käyttö, ylläpito Käyttötapaukset esimerkkeinä eri hyödyntäjille Suunnitellaan yleiskäyttöisiksi WSN toteutusteknologiasta Yleiskäyttöisiä komponentteja Referenssitoteutuksia eri teknologioiden käyttöönottoon (kesken) 25
26
27 Dokumentin nimi Openapi Introduction WSN Management Format (WMF) Meta-Data Format (MEDF) Sensor Information Data Format (SIDF) Sensor Archive Data Format (SADF) Node Actuator and Sensor Control (NASC) Sensor Data Communication (SDC) Using SIMPLE WSN openapi White Paper Tyyppi Dokumentti, joka kuvaa suunnitellun yleisen rakenteen. Dokumentti, joka kuvaa rajapinnan, jonka yli voidaan hallita Gateway:n yhteyksiä muihin järjestelmiin, asettamaan mitä sensoriverkko mittaa, asettamaan hälytysrajoja, kysymään verkon ja yhteyksien tilaa sekä loogista rakennetta. Dokumentti, joka kuvaa tavan (datalehti), jolla esitetään mistä mittausnode koostuu, mihin se pystyy ja mitä tietoa se lähettää. Dokumentti kuvaa myös tavan datalehden pyytämiseen Dokumentti, joka kuvaa mittaustiedon esittämisen tapahtumapohjaisesti XML- ja CSV-formaatteina. Dokumentti, joka kuvaa mittaustiedon esittämisen ja pyytämisen XML- ja CSV-formaatteina. Dokumentti, joka kuvaa komentojen lähettämisen nodelle XML- ja CSV-formaatteina. Dokumentti, joka kuvaa mittaustiedon tai vastaavan datapaketin siirtoa hyödyntäen SIP:n pikaviesti metodia SIMPLE määrityksien mukaan. Whitepaper- yleiskuvaus rajapintamäärittelyistä.
Toimintamalli 28
Tärkeimmät WSN-standardit 29
Tarve? Ratkaisu - Kokonaisvaltaiset pilotit - Käyttökelpoiset rajapinnat 30
31 Tomi Suominen arvio, että lämpötilan ja ilmankosteuden optimaalisella hallinnalla voidaan saavuttaa maksimissaan jopa 10% parannus satoon. (Lepolan Puutarha Oy)
Johtopäätöksiä 32
Teknologian kehitys 33 Range (and mobility) 10 km 1 km 100 m 10 m 1 m 10 cm 1 cm RTLS Active RFID RFID 1 B/min (0.1mW) Cellular WSN 1 kbit/s (1mW) 3G 10 kbit/s (10 mw) WPAN WMAN Satellite WLAN 1 Mbit/s 100 mw UWB WiMax 100 Mbit/s 1 W + 802.11n 802.15.3 Data rates (and energy)
Teknologia: Diagnostiikka ja verkonhallinta 34
WSN performance analyzer toolset Robustness Functions (node) 5 Autonomy (node) Installation (system) 4 Field configuration (node) 3 Installation (node) Lifetime (node) 2 1 0 Security (node) Density of nodes (system) Price (node) Range (node) Size (node) Max number of nodes (system) Mobility (node) Sampling interval (node) Passive RFID WSN 35
Sovellukset: Yhteisöt? 36
Pilottimalli: teknologiasta sovelluksiin Sovellustarpeen määrittely Sovelluksen feasibilityanalyysi (teknologiat ja sovellus tarve) Sovelluksen nopea pilotointi Sovelluskehitys ja integrointi Sovelluspilotti ja käyttökokemukset Tuotteen ja palvelun viimeistely Service providers (services using sensor services) Sensor service providers System integrators Sensor network products Nodes and modules Components 37
Yhteenveto haasteet ratkaisut Tekniikka Yhden pisteen optimointeja Ei vakiintuneita rajapintoja ja työkaluja De-facto standardin puuttuminen - ja luja usko siihen Sovellukset killer-sovelluksen puuttuminen - ja luja usko siihen ( enabloiva teknologia ) Yksittäinen helppo mittaustieto on halpa ( hyvä idea jos joku maksaa ) Tekniikka Kokonaisuuden hallinta WSN kootaan komponenteista ei yhdestä isosta standardista (standards, custom, proprietary) Sovellukset Piloteilla uusia sovellusalueita ja liiketoimintamalleja Vaikeat ympäristöt ja yksinkertaiset sovellukset ensin Internet of things vaatii myös uutta teknologiaa (koko, energia, tarkkuus) 38